About this experience
Whether you are just starting, are a hobbyist or have years of experience, our team of professional photographers will find superb photographic opportunities for all kinds of interests. Capture not just the grand landmarks, but the stream of car lights and the blurred passing of boats on the River Thames. Take advantage of the one-on-one experience of our private and personalised tour to develop your own creative vision while offering practical tips on photographing in low light and long exposures. Each tour is crafted to the skills and needs of the participants. Apart from taking photos, you can also expect to learn: - Night photography basics - Expert local photography knowledge of the city - Taking control of your camera: f-stop, shutter speed, ISO and focusing - Long exposure light streaking - cars, boats - Reviewing your photography

Where it starts and ends
Meeting point
London
On the east side of Westminster Bridge (opposite side of the river to Big Ben) and the south side (opposite side to the London Eye) is a set of stairs. Lets meet on the bridge, next to the stairs, under the street lamp.

What are the best things to do in London?
+
London's best attractions split cleanly: the museums are free and need no booking, so the paid market is about views, theatre and getting out of the city for a day. When is the best time to visit London?
+
May to September for long evenings, December for the Christmas markets. Booking patterns follow the same curve: prices and queues climb in peak weeks, while shoulder season gives you better availability on the top-ranked experiences and more room to change plans.
How many days do you need in London?
+
Three full days covers the headline sights without sprinting. A workable rhythm is one anchor experience each morning, such as this one, an unhurried afternoon in a single neighborhood, then a food or nightlife booking in the evening. Five days lets you add a day trip outside the city.
